The police specifically use flash devices both at danger spots and in accident areas to detect speeding and other violations of the road traffic regulations (StVO), such as bussgeldkatalog.de explained. A distinction is made between stationary and mobile speed cameras. While stationary speed cameras are usually installed at accident hotspots, mobile devices can be used flexibly.
Road safety and tolerances for speed cameras
The most common traffic violations are speeding, which is also the main cause of accidents. Loud bussgeldkatalog.org Special tolerances apply when measuring. For speeds below 100 km/h a deduction of 3 km/h is made, while for speeds above 100 km/h 3 percentage points are deducted from the measured value. Some types of speed cameras can even impose higher deductions.
The police in Germany use different speed measurement methods to detect traffic offenders. These methods include stationary measurements as well as mobile techniques using laser guns that enable precise speed measurements. Video tracking systems are also used to record traffic violations.
Possible consequences and fines
Driving bans can be imposed if you exceed the speed limit at 21 km/h in urban areas, while the threshold is 26 km/h outside of urban areas. Violations of the speed limits can be punished not only with fines, but also with points in Flensburg.
In addition, speed camera apps that warn of speed cameras are often used, but are illegal when operational. Owning these apps is not prohibited, but using them in traffic can result in fines.
The installation of speed cameras involves considerable costs, which can range between 20,000 and 250,000 euros. This is underpinned by the need to ensure road safety and enforce compliance with traffic rules.
